Except that the 5700XT is 40 CU and 2150MHz is at its maximum power. 2000MHZ will use quite a bit less power because it's not going to be quite as close to it's voltage limit.
Besides, we already know how much power a 36 CU Navi consumes at ~2000MHz.
![]()
Flashing a Radeon RX 5700 to 5700 XT: Free 10% Performance Boost
In addition to our launch day reviews of the Radeon RX 5700 and 5700 XT, we followed up with extended comparisons, overclocking, and more. Most recently enthusiasts...www.techspot.com
People have flashed the 5700XT Bios to the base 5700. At around 2000MHz the 5700 draws 216W.
Let's not pretend that 216W is some thermally unmanageable monstrosity. It'll likely pull less power than a 56 CU GPU.
We can do a bit of armchair mathematics to prove it too.
36CU @ ~1700MHz = ~160W
36CU @ ~2000MHz = ~220W
56CU is 55% more CUs than 36CU.
If we assume power consumption scales linearly with larger chips then:
56CU @ 1700MHz = 160*1.55
= 248W
Thing is power doesn't necessarily scale linearly so it might actually be more than 250W for the 56CU part.
If we add in the CPU components which at ~3.2GHz will likely consume about 50W then we get something like this:
36 CU APU @ 2000MHz = ~ 270W
56 CU APU @ 1700MHZ = ~ 300W
Now Navi ships with pretty aggressive vcores so I think Sony and Microsoft might factory undervolt their chips to meet power consumption targets so end power consumption might be lower that we predict. But no matter which way you slice it the PS5 will draw less power than the XSX assuming the GitHub leaks are still representative of the final product.
And might I add. 250-300W total thermal output is not that big in the grand scheme of things.
AIB manufacturers can provide sufficiently quiet cooling for such TDPs without the explicit need for liquid cooling. And if the PS5 needs liquid, then the XSX sure as hell will need it too.
